Abstract
An earlier model for () -wave phase shifts from current algebra and partially conserved axial-vector current is extended to the () -wave phase shifts in the isospin-½ channel. The solutions depend on a cutoff parameter and give the scattering length in the range , a broad maximum of the phase shift in the range 1200-1500 MeV, and a slow decrease to zero at higher energies. The height of the maximum is cutoff-dependent; its value has been estimated by requiring saturation of the () Adler-Weisberger relation. The results are applied to give information on the form factors of decay. In particular, we find .
